Your Sunshine Pantry Checklist
- 2 ½ cups all-purpose flour – The trusty backbone! For gluten-free magic, swap 1:1 with your favorite GF blend.
- 1 cup softened unsalted butter – Pro tip: Leave it on the counter during your morning coffee for perfect spreadability. Vegan? Coconut oil works wonders!
- Zest of 1 large orange – Channel your inner citrus artist! Use a microplane and stop at the white pith—that’s where bitterness hides.
- 1 cup white chocolate chips – Optional but glorious. Swap with dark chocolate for contrast, or dried cranberries for tang.
- ¼ tsp orange extract – The flavor booster! No extract? Double the zest and add 1 tsp orange blossom water.
Let’s Bake Some Sunshine ☀️
Step 1: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Line sheets with parchment—trust me, it’s the difference between “Instagram-worthy” and “scraping pan crumbles.”
Step 2: Whisk dry ingredients like you’re conducting an orchestra. That baking soda? It’s your cookie’s yoga instructor—helps them stretch and breathe.
Step 3: Cream butter, sugar, and zest until it’s fluffier than a summer cloud. This isn’t just mixing—you’re creating tiny air pockets for melt-in-your-mouth texture!
Step 4: Crack in the egg, then vanilla and orange extract. Stream in OJ slowly—we want emulsion, not citrus soup!
Step 5: Marriage time! Gradually mix dry into wet. Stop when just combined—overmixing makes tough cookies. Fold in chips like you’re tucking them into bed.
Step 6: Scoop 1.5 tbsp dough balls. Want perfect rounds? Roll briefly between palms. Bake 10-12 minutes until edges whisper golden—they’ll firm up as they cool!

Your Questions, My Answers 🔍
Q: Why are my cookies spreading like pancake batter?
A: Butter’s likely too warm! Chill dough 30 minutes pre-baking. Also check your baking soda’s expiration—old leaveners won’t lift properly.
Q: Can I use bottled orange juice?
A: Fresh is best for bright flavor, but in a pinch, use bottled. Skip the “from concentrate” stuff—it’s too sweet!
Q: How long do these keep?
A: 5 days in airtight containers—if they last that long! Freeze dough balls for 3 months; bake straight from freezer (+1 minute bake time).

Summer Creamsicle Orange Cookies
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 24 cookies 1x
Ingredients
2 ½ cups all-purpose flour
¾ tsp baking soda
½ tsp salt
1 cup unsalted butter, softened
1 cup granulated sugar
Zest of 1 large orange
1 egg
1 tsp vanilla extract
¼ tsp orange extract (optional, but boosts flavor)
2 tbsp fresh orange juice
1 cup white chocolate chips
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per.
In a bowl, whisk flour, baking soda, and salt.
In another bowl, cream butter, sugar, and orange zest until light and fluffy.
Add egg, vanilla, orange extract, and orange juice. Mix until combined.
Slowly add dry ingredients to wet, then fold in white chocolate chips.
Scoop dough onto baking sheet (about 1.5 tbsp each).
Bake for 10–12 minutes, until edges are just golden. Cool before serving.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 10 minutes
